About Peerspace

Peerspace is the leading marketplace for hourly venue rentals for meetings, productions, and events. The company opens doors to the most inspiring spaces around the world, from lofts and mansions to storefronts and studios. Peerspace welcomes guests to over 40,000 spaces where they can bring their creative ideas to life, and empowers hosts to earn additional income simply by opening their doors.

Great Site for Finding and Booking Spaces I used PeerSpace to book a studio for a photoshoot. The site is easy to use and there were a lot of rental spaces available from which I can choose. You can opt to pay for the rental all at once or in 2 installments (for a small fee). You receive constant reminders about your upcoming booking. The service fee is a little hard to swallow but the fact that you have single site to peruse different locations with photos and pricing makes it worthwhile.

False Advertising! False Advertising! Peerspace $50 referral codes are fakes. Clicking a referral link just redirects it to Peerspace.com start page. Be warned: I emailed their customer service and was told to try creating an account first. Which if you do will in fact make you ineligible for the referral bonus. As per their terms: "Referral credits will only be issued for new users (people who do not already have a Peerspace account)"!
